Ingredients

Servings: 4
  • 300 g Raspberries (alternatively frozen)
  • 1 Lime
  • 1 l Buttermilk
  • 100 ml Milk
  • 6 TABLESPOONS liquid honey
  • 4 wooden skewers

Directions

  1. 1

    Sort the raspberries and put 12 beautiful berries aside. (Defrost frozen raspberries at least 3 hours before at room temperature). Wash the lime, rub dry, cut in half and cut off 4 thin slices.

  2. 2

    Squeeze the rest of the lime. Puree raspberries and pass through a sieve. Mix buttermilk, milk, lime juice and honey. Pour buttermilk into the glasses and spread the raspberry puree into the glasses.

  3. 3

    Stir gently with a spoon to form streaks. Put raspberries and lime slices on wooden skewers. Serve a fruit skewer with each glass.
